I’m using several analog synths and effects like korg ms-10, mooger-fooger ring modulator and so on…
These instruments know how to work with CV signals.
The only way I know how to operate those CV is using other CV instruments like other analog effects, the CP-251 (moog) if anyone knows and so on…
The problems is that i don’t know how to create those CV signals from cubase or any other sequencer or VST, for example - I want to create a sine-wave which is synchronized with my BPM in cubase and send it to my analog phaser, or I want to send other CV signals to the KORG (to play it).
I know that there is a MIDI-CV converted, but is there a way or a VST that know how to create CV signals???
I’ve read on the creamware forum of people who have done this using the creamware modular to create a modulating signal, run this signal out of one of their audio outs through a preamp and on to their modulars, so it is definitely possible. And a guy modified his nord g2x to do this, too:
It looks to be a pretty simple DIY project (just a couple ICs, resistors, capacitors) for extracting Cv signals directly from a Windows based PC MIDI. All you need is a printer port!
It’s pretty expandable (up to 80 cv outs) and looks about as simple as a DIY circuit could be (for those who are not soldering iron experienced).
